China & Russia strengthen friendship, blasting Western ’neocolonialism’ & US militarism

Putin met with Xi Jinping in Beijing, where China and Russia released a joint statement blasting Western “colonialism and hegemonism“, supporting a multipolar world and more representation for the Global South, and calling for de-dollarization and expansion of BRICS. Ben Norton analyzes the historic document.
